5203 |a"We sought a practical, inexpensive way to measure water motion, as for example, mean velocities at asalmon farm. The method tested was based on the dissolution rate of pre-cast gypsum cylinders of ~250-g mass, expressed as the percentage loss of weight of each cylinder (F%). F% is given as velocity or cumulative flow for a specified exposure period based on data from flume calibration. Comparisons made between gypsum dissolution rate methods and standard current meters (S4 and acoustic doppler current profiler) showed that the gypsum dissolution method overestimates mean velocities. It was concluded that the gypsum dissolution method cannot provide a measure of mean velocity in the well mixed waters of the Bay of Fundy"--Abstract, page iii.
